Bumps taskcluster from 64.2.8 to 65.1.0.

Release notes

Sourced from taskcluster's releases.

v65.1.0

USERS

▶ [minor] #5967 Allows Docker Worker payloads to be used on the insecure Generic Worker engine, translated by d2g.

v65.0.2

USERS

▶ [patch] #7025 Fixes JavaScript error in "Create Worker Pool" page that was introduced in the last release. Adds link to "Errors" in workers navigation bar.

Automated Package Updates

  • --- updated-dependencies: - dependency-name: requests dependency-type: indirect ... (42569ccb7)
  • build(deps-dev): bump eslint from 8.57.0 to 9.3.0 in /clients/client-web (2bccd8b63)

v65.0.1

GENERAL

▶ [patch] Upgrades to go1.22.3 (SECURITY release). Was supposed to be handled in PR #7006, but was accidentally left out.

v65.0.0

WORKER-DEPLOYERS

▶ [MAJOR] #7017 Generic Worker multiuser engine now places task directories under /home (Linux and FreeBSD) and /Users on macOS. Previously it was placing them under / by default on all three platforms, unless either HOME was set to a non-standard value in the process launching Generic Worker multiuser engine, or if tasksDir was explicitly set in Generic Worker config.

This is a bug fix, but due to being a significant change in behaviour, is being released as a major change to trigger a major version bump.

USERS

▶ [patch] #6117 Fixes Worker page when queue information was missing and error was displayed. If worker-manager data exists for this worker, it would be displayed instead.

▶ [patch] #6117 Workers in UI use consistent navigation element that allows to switch between worker pool definition,
